Sony A7C vs A99

The Sony Alpha A7C and the Sony Alpha SLT-A99 are two digital cameras that were announced, respectively, in September 2020 and September 2012. The A7C is a mirrorless interchangeable lens camera, while the A99 is a DSLR. Both cameras are equipped with a full frame sensor. Both cameras offer a resolution of 24 megapixels.

Body comparison

The side-by-side display below illustrates the physical size and weight of the Sony A7C and the Sony A99. The two cameras are presented according to their relative size. Three successive views from the front, the top, and the rear are shown. All size dimensions are rounded to the nearest millimeter.

The A7C can be obtained in two different colors (black, silver), while the A99 is only available in black.

Size Sony A7C vs Sony A99
Compare A7C versus A99 top
Comparison A7C or A99 rear

If the front view area (width x height) of the cameras is taken as an aggregate measure of their size, the Sony A99 is considerably larger (85 percent) than the Sony A7C. Moreover, the A99 is substantially heavier (60 percent) than the A7C. In this context, it is worth noting that both cameras are splash and dust-proof and can, hence, be used in inclement weather conditions or harsh environments.

The above size and weight comparisons are to some extent incomplete since they do not consider the interchangeable lenses that both of these cameras require. Hence, you might want to study and compare the specifications of available lenses in order to get the full picture of the size and weight of the two camera systems.

Concerning battery life, the A7C gets 740 shots out of its Sony NP-FZ100 battery, while the A99 can take 500 images on a single charge of its Sony NP-FM500H power pack. The power pack in the A7C can be charged via the USB port, so that it is not always necessary to take the battery charger along when travelling.

Any camera decision will obviously take relative prices into account. The retail prices at the time of the camera’s release place the model in the market relative to other models in the producer’s line-up and the competition. The A7C was launched at a markedly lower price (by 36 percent) than the A99, which puts it into a different market segment. Usually, retail prices stay at first close to the launch price, but after several months, discounts become available. Later in the product cycle and, in particular, when the replacement model is about to appear, further discounting and stock clearance sales often push the camera price considerably down.

Sensor comparison

The imaging sensor is at the core of digital cameras and its size is one of the main determining factors of image quality. All other things equal, a large sensor will have larger individual pixel-units that offer better low-light sensitivity, wider dynamic range, and richer color-depth than smaller pixels in a sensor of the same technological generation. Further, a large sensor camera will give the photographer additional creative options when using shallow depth-of-field to isolate a subject from its background. On the downside, larger sensors tend to be more expensive and lead to bigger and heavier cameras and lenses.

Both cameras under consideration feature a full frame sensor, but their sensors differ slightly in size. The sensor area in the A99 is 1 percent bigger. They nevertheless have the same format factor of 1.0. Both cameras have a native aspect ratio (sensor width to sensor height) of 3:2.

Sony A7C and Sony A99 sensor measures

Even though the A99 has a slightly larger sensor, both cameras offer the same resolution of 24 megapixels. This implies that the A99 has a lower pixel density and marginally larger individual pixels (with a pixel pitch of 5.96μm versus 5.94μm for the A7C), which gives it a potential advantage in terms of light gathering capacity. It should, however, be noted that the A7C is much more recent (by 8 years) than the A99, and its sensor will have benefitted from technological advances during this time that at least partly compensate for the smaller pixel size.

The A7C has on-sensor phase detect pixels, which results in fast and reliable autofocus acquisition even during live view operation.

The Sony Alpha A7C has a native sensitivity range from ISO 100 to ISO 51200, which can be extended to ISO 50-204800. The corresponding ISO settings for the Sony Alpha SLT-A99 are ISO 100 to ISO 25600, with the possibility to increase the ISO range to 50-25600.

In terms of underlying technology, the A7C is build around a BSI-CMOS sensor, while the A99 uses a CMOS imager. Both cameras use a Bayer filter for capturing RGB colors on a square grid of photosensors. This arrangement is found in most digital cameras.

Many modern cameras are not only capable of taking still images, but can also record movies. Both cameras under consideration have a sensor with sufficiently fast read-out times for moving pictures, but the A7C provides a higher video resolution than the A99. It can shoot video footage at 4K/30p, while the A99 is limited to 1080/60p.

One differentiating feature between the two cameras concerns the touch sensitivity of the rear screen. The A7C has a touchscreen, while the A99 has a conventional panel. Touch control can be particularly helpful, for example, for setting the focus point.

Both cameras have an articulated rear screen that can be turned to be front-facing. This feature will be particularly appreciated by vloggers and photographers who are interested in taking selfies.

The reported shutter speed information refers to the use of the mechanical shutter. Yet, some cameras only have an electronic shutter, while others have an electronic shutter in addition to a mechanical one. In fact, the A7C is one of those camera that have an additional electronic shutter, which makes completely silent shooting possible. However, this mode is less suitable for photographing moving objects (risk of rolling shutter) or shooting under artificial light sources (risk of flickering).

The Sony A7C has an intervalometer built-in. This enables the photographer to capture time lapse sequences, such as flower blooming, a sunset or moon rise, without purchasing an external camera trigger and related software.

Concerning the storage of imaging data, both the A7C and the A99 write their files to SDXC or Memory Stick PRO Duo cards. The A99 features dual card slots, which can be very useful in case a memory card fails. In contrast, the A7C only has one slot. The A7C supports UHS-II cards (Ultra High Speed data transfer of up to 312 MB/s), while the A99 can use UHS-I cards (up to 104 MB/s).

It is notable that the A7C offers wifi support, while the A99 does not. Wifi can be a very convenient means to transfer image data to an off-camera location.

Studio photographers will appreciate that the Sony A99 (unlike the A7C) features a PC Sync socket, so that professional strobe lights can be controlled by the camera.

Travel and landscape photographers will find it useful that the A99 has an internal geolocalization sensor and can record GPS coordinates in its EXIF data.
